Statute of limitations
A lawsuit against negligent asbestos manufacturers must be filed within a certain time frame, called the statute of limitations. The clock begins ticking when a victim or their family members learn that they have an asbestos-related condition and it is crucial to act as quickly as is possible.
A successful asbestos lawsuit (try Ns 7) could compensate a victim or their loved family members for their losses, which include medical bills, home health care costs lost wages, loss of quality of life, as well as funeral and burial costs. Mesothelioma patients may also be eligible for compensation for suffering and pain mental anguish, loss of consortium.
In some states the statute of limitations begins to run out when they begin to show signs of an asbestos-related disease such as lung cancer or asbestosis. Since mesothelioma may take a long time to manifest, a lot of asbestos victims are not aware of their diagnosis until the time limit has passed. For this reason, it is crucial to speak with an asbestos attorney as soon as you can.
Asbestos litigation can be a complex area, and several factors can affect the statutes of limitation. For example, the location of the asbestos exposure or employer will determine the state's statute of limitation that applies to a claim. Additionally, those who have been diagnosed with more than one asbestos-related disease may be subject to different statutes of limitations.

Asbestos sufferers should also think about filing a claim with an asbestos trust fund in order to receive compensation for their injuries. These funds are set up by companies who once manufactured asbestos-based products to pay for victims’ medical expenses, compensation and other damages. Asbestos Litigation in New York
New York is a prime location for asbestos litigation. The state is third nationally for the number of asbestos cases filed and second for mesothelioma-specific claims. Asbestos-related diseases can develop over time after exposure. They may cause devastating complications like m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Asbestos lawsuits are different from the typical personal injury case. These cases can be complex and require specialized knowledge of asbestos laws, regulations, and procedures. In addition, the plaintiffs usually suffer from serious illness such as m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ases that require accelerated filing of their claims.
Plaintiffs who are defendants in New York often face difficulty defending summary judgment motions against mesothelioma claims. Prior to the recent decisions in Nemeth Parker and Juni, defendants often lost these motions based solely on the expert testimony of plaintiffs to prove causality.
These recent rulings give New York asbestos defense lawyers some hope. In three separate cases, the Appellate Division of the First Department overturned summary judgment denials and dismissed them against tile manufacturers who failed to provide evidence from counter-experts that quantified the levels of friable fibers contained in their product.
The cases were handled by Justice Sherry Klein Heitler in NYCAL. Heitler has managed the NYCAL docket since 2008, when she replaced former Assembly Speaker Sheldon Silver after his conviction on federal corruption charges of accepting referral fees from Weitz & Luxenberg to steer asbestos lawsuits to her company. The NYCAL cases have been consolidated to streamline the trial process.

A poor exposure at work can lead to a variety of lung diseases, including mesothelioma. Exposure can occur on ships and bases power plants, shipyards, repair, construction, and other industries. Workers who worked in insulation, pipefitting and boiler making as well as heating systems and shipbuilding are at risk of being exposed to asbestos. Families of those who work in these industries could also be at risk for mesothelioma.

How to File a Claim
A successful asbestos claim can compensate victims for their medical expenses, lost income and pain and suffering. It may also cover funeral costs and other financial losses. A mesothelioma attorney can help victims and their families file an asbestos legal lawsuit or seek compensation through other legal avenues, like trust funds or veterans' benefits from the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A).
To be eligible for a mesothelioma settlement, it is essential to have an accurate record of the diagnosis and history of exposure to asbestos. This includes medical records, as along with documents from your job and witness testimony. Mesothelioma attorneys collaborate with specialists who look over these records and ensure they are as robust as possible to support the case.
An experienced asbestos lawyer will begin the process of filing a lawsuit by writing a document referred to as a complaint. This document, also known as a pleading, provides the legal reasons behind the lawsuit, and lists asbestos companies as defendants. This document also includes a list of the losses and injuries you suffered.
In many states there is a statute of limitations which imposes a deadline on asbestos lawsuits.
